![]() ![]() ![]() List scan simply prints the specified addresses without sending a single packet to the target. The list scan option ( -sL) is useful for making sure that correct addresses are specified before doing the real scan: ![]() Note: The ending 0 in the above example does not have an effect: nmap 10.1.1.0/24 and for example nmap 10.1.1.134/24 commands are the same.
